Pixel 10a CAD Renders Hint at Near-Identical Design and Early 2026 Launch

Leaked images suggest Google is prioritizing cost control with a boosted Tensor G4 over flagship silicon.

Overview

  • Android Headlines published CAD-based renders with OnLeaks that depict a Pixel 10a closely resembling the 9a’s flat plastic back and flush dual-camera layout.
  • OnLeaks cautioned that bezels in the images look slimmer than the real device is expected to have, and CADs may omit or misstate details like the SIM tray.
  • Reported dimensions are roughly 153.9 x 72.9 x 9mm with a 6.2-inch display, the same button placement as the 9a, and symmetrical bottom speaker and mic cutouts.
  • Multiple outlets expect a higher-clocked Tensor G4 instead of the Tensor G5, likely UFS 3.1 storage, about a 5,100mAh battery, and a starting price near $499 with extended software support.
  • Coverage now points to an early or March 2026 debut after earlier late-2025 rumors, with only modest performance or efficiency gains anticipated over the Pixel 9a.
